evaluated antipyretic activity. The antipyretic activity was studied using Brewerâ€™s yeast induced hyperpyrexia method in Wistar
strain albino rats. The ethanol extract at a dose of 200mg/kg & 400mg/kg were evaluated for antipyretic activity. The extract of
Barringtonia acutangula plant showed a significant (P<0.01) dose dependent antipyretic effect in yeast induced elevation of
body temperature in experimental rats. The results showed that the extract contains some pharmacologically active principles
and lend pharmacological credence to the ethanomedical use of the plant in the management of pyrexia and it shows significant
antipyretic activity when compared with the standard drug</Abstract><Email> sandhyaguggilla9@gmail.com</Email><articletype>Research</articletype><volume>4</volume><issue>2</issue><year>2014</year><keyword>Barringtonia acutangula,Brewerâ€™s Yeast,Antipyretic activity</keyword><AUTHORS>G.
